What is a bank reference letter used for?

A bank reference letter confirms the client's relationship with the bank and is usually requested to open accounts abroad, for visa or residency processes, or for commercial procedures. For international use it may require an apostille.

Before the apostille

Key points about your bank reference letter

A bank reference letter is a private document; before it can be apostilled the signature usually must be notarized or authenticated.

Official bank letterhead

Ideally the letter should be issued on the bank's official letterhead.

A signature that can be authenticated

The signature may need notarization or authentication; the procedure depends on who signs and in which state.

Some banks don't notarize signatures

In that case we find the right route (for example, a certification or a notarized statement).

We review before promising the procedure

We first review the letter to confirm that it can be apostilled and how.

Must the letter be on bank letterhead?+
Ideally yes; the letter should be issued on the bank's official letterhead. We review it first to confirm it can be apostilled.
Does the signature need notarization?+
Frequently yes, or authentication. The procedure depends on who signs and in which state.
What if the bank doesn't notarize?+
In that case we look for another valid route, such as a certification or a notarized statement.
Which state is it apostilled in?+
In the state where the signature is notarized or authenticated.
Does it include translation?+
Translation is a separate service. When the destination country requires it, we can coordinate a certified translation.
